The Complete Overview of How to Use a Computer Monitor as TV
The foundation of repurposing a monitor as a television lies in its core functionality: both devices are essentially displays, but their intended use cases dictate how they’re driven. A monitor is designed to receive input from a computer via ports like DisplayPort, HDMI, or DVI, while a TV is optimized for broadcast signals, streaming devices, and gaming consoles. The overlap is significant—modern monitors support HDMI 2.0/2.1, 4K resolution, and even HDR, making them technically capable of replacing a TV. The challenge is ensuring the transition doesn’t degrade picture quality or introduce latency.
Success hinges on three pillars: hardware compatibility, signal routing, and software configuration. A monitor with an HDMI 2.0 port can handle 4K at 60Hz, while HDMI 2.1 unlocks 120Hz for gaming or 8K resolution. However, not all monitors support Dolby Vision or advanced audio passthrough, which are common in high-end TVs. The solution often involves using an external device—like a Fire Stick, Apple TV, or gaming console—as the primary input source, while the monitor itself acts as the display. This approach bypasses the monitor’s built-in OS (if any) and leverages the device’s native media capabilities.

Core Mechanisms: How It Works
The technical process of using a monitor as a TV revolves around signal input and output management. At its core, the monitor becomes a passive display, relying on an external device (e.g., a Fire Stick, Xbox, or Blu-ray player) to process media. The monitor’s role is limited to rendering the signal it receives, which means its native OS—if present—is irrelevant. For example, a Dell UltraSharp monitor with a built-in OS (like some business displays) can ignore its touchscreen or management software entirely, focusing solely on HDMI/DisplayPort input.
Critical factors include resolution scaling, refresh rate, and color accuracy. If your monitor supports 4K but your streaming device only outputs 1080p, the image will upscale, potentially introducing artifacts. Conversely, a 1080p monitor connected to a 4K console will downscale, losing detail. Input lag—critical for gamers—must also be considered. While monitors excel here (often under 5ms), some TVs use motion smoothing that can introduce artificial delays. The solution? Use the monitor’s "Game Mode" or disable any built-in processing to ensure raw performance.

Comprehensive FAQs
Q: Can I use any computer monitor as a TV?
A: Most modern monitors can function as TVs, but compatibility depends on ports, resolution, and refresh rate support. Ensure your monitor has HDMI 2.0/2.1 or DisplayPort 1.4 for 4K/120Hz content. Older monitors (e.g., 1080p with HDMI 1.4) may struggle with newer consoles or streaming devices.
Q: Do I need a special cable to connect a monitor to a TV source?
A: No, but the right cable is critical. Use HDMI 2.0/2.1 for 4K/120Hz, DisplayPort for high-refresh-rate gaming, and avoid composite/S-Video for modern setups. Some monitors may require an active adapter (e.g., HDMI to DisplayPort) if the source device lacks the right port.
Q: Will using a monitor as a TV affect its lifespan?
A: Not significantly, provided you avoid excessive heat or physical stress. Monitors are built for continuous use, and modern displays handle entertainment workloads just as well as productivity tasks. However, avoid leaving it on 24/7 if it lacks proper cooling.
Q: Can I use my monitor as a TV without a streaming device?
A: Yes, but with limitations. You can connect a gaming console, Blu-ray player, or even a laptop running media software (e.g., VLC, Plex). For smart features (Netflix, YouTube), an external device like a Fire Stick or Apple TV is essential.
Q: How do I reduce input lag when using a monitor as a TV?
A: Disable any motion smoothing or processing features in the monitor’s OSD menu. Enable "Game Mode" or "PC Mode" to bypass unnecessary signal processing. For consoles, ensure the monitor is set to the correct resolution/refresh rate to avoid upscaling delays.
Q: Is it worth it to use a monitor instead of buying a TV?
A: It depends on your needs. If you prioritize performance (high refresh rates, color accuracy) and don’t need built-in smart features, a monitor is a superior choice. For large-screen viewing or premium audio, a dedicated TV may still be preferable.
Q: Can I mount my monitor on the wall like a TV?
A: Yes, if it has a VESA mount. Most modern monitors support this, but check the mount size (e.g., 100x100mm) before purchasing a bracket. Wall mounting improves viewing angles and saves space, making it ideal for multi-monitor or home theater setups.
